Invisible Wings

Contributed by blueeyedevil13 on Saturday, 5th March 2005 @ 04:13:17 AM in AEST
Topic: Suicide



Waiting hopefully here
Hoping to have lost a reason to shed more tears
Wishing I was there to save you
Trying to make believe nothing is true

Graves should be reserved for only the old
The young should never have to be deathly cold
We don’t want people to die
But they do, there’s no use in lies

Confront the stranger in your heart
Feel your way through dark
Vanquish your fears, and love yourself more
Try to fly, and pick yourself up off the floor

Sitting by the phone
Hoping you’re alive at home
Waiting for that call
That will put an end to it all

We’ve all tried to sew up the rip
In our hearts, and mend a broken friendship
But you put an end to everything we had
I knew you were hurting, but I never thought it was this bad

Confront the stranger in your heart
Feel your way through dark
Vanquish your fears, and love yourself more
Try to fly, and pick yourself up off the floor

If you could see me now
Maybe you’d see my pain somehow

The phone rings
Afraid of the news this call brings
I whisper “Hello?”
But I already know

Confront the stranger in your heart
Feel your way through dark
Vanquish your fears, and love yourself more
Try to fly, and pick yourself up off the floor

But like you, I cannot do any of these things
Because like you, I believe I have no wings
